## Usage

```rust
use tracing_subscriber::prelude::*;

tracing_subscriber::Registry::default()
    .with(tracing_flat_json::FlatJsonLayer::new(std::io::stdout))
    .init();
```

## Feature Flags

- `tracing-log`: Handle [`log`] events emitted by [`tracing-log`]. Enabled
  by default.
- `tracing-opentelemetry`: Outputs the `trace_id` added to spans by
  [`tracing-opentelemetry`]. May not work when compiled with multiple
  versions of [`tracing-opentelemetry`] in the same executable.

## Output Format

Included:

- timestamp (RFC3339 UTC)
- level
- `trace_id` (with feature `tracing-opentelemetry`)
- `code.file.path`
- `code.line.number`
- event message
- event fields, source code order
- parent span fields, source code order, latest span first, root span last

Excluded:

- span names
- `target`
- `span_id`
- duplicate fields (only latest value for each field name)
